Dodgers News: Dave Roberts Gives Justin Turner The Night Off
Justin Turner missed 4 straight games towards the end of May. His hamstring injury occurred during the crazy comeback win against the Mets last Wednesday night. Announced this afternoon, Dave Roberts will give Turner the night off.
